        I think respecting your wife's wishes, however crazy, is a good idea. As for batch operations you can do it now. If you have these photos in a Set then go to your set and click on the Edit as Batch link underneath the Set description. Then click the tab titled Batch Operations. On the right hand side then are some radio-buttons to change the Privacy of the selected photos. regards, Paul Watson South Africa The Code Project Pope Pius II said "The only prescription is more cowbell.                   Judd wrote: do you know what the 'default' is for licensing? The default is that you own all the rights. The new interface they put on about a week ago will display "© All rights reserved" on all the photos.
